§ 6502. Immediate Notification of Death or Disappearance.
(a) When, as a result of an occurrence that involves a vessel or its equipment, a person dies or disappears from a vessel, the operator shall, without delay, by the quickest means available, notify the Department of Boating and Waterways and the nearest enforcement agency having jurisdiction over the waterbody of:
